Analysis

The most recent figure for cooling and heating degree days - cities and fuas — change in cooling in Lorient is 254.55 % change on previous year, measured in 2025.

The figure is up 306.7% on the previous year and up 132.9% over ten years.

Over the whole period, cooling and heating degree days - cities and fuas — change in cooling in Lorient peaked at 991.23 % change on previous year in 2022 and was at its lowest, -773.21 % change on previous year, in 2015.

Lorient ranks 13th of 1306 regions on this measure, in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.
